1. Interview Your Realtor

Interview Your Realtor
When it’s time to hire a real estate agent, you should tackle it as if you were hiring an employee. Remember your realtor ultimately works for you, not the other party involved in the transaction.

Before hiring an agent, you should interview them. Narrow down a list of questions you may have about the process, their fees, and services. Asking the right questions will allow you to make an informed decision.

2. Consider Real Estate Agents That Offer Incentives

Like retailers, not all real estate agents offer the same services and offers. Some realtors offer incentives such as flat-fee listings or discounted commissions. However, you should be wary of huge savings and pay close attention to their contract.

3. Sit Down with Several Realtors to Discuss Your Options

It may be tempting to call and hire a top local realtor on the spot. Yet, you should take the time to sit down with several realtors who focus on your market and the type of property you want to sell or buy. When you hire a real estate agent, you recruit an agent to market your home or find your dream home. Either way, it’s important to work with someone you connect and understands your needs. The right realtor will explain their strategy to sell or find your dream home.

4. Ask for References and Call Them

When you meet with potential realtors, you should request references and contact them. Talking to their clients will help you learn about their experiences and what to expect. Don’t take their word or online testimonials for it.

5. Read Your Contract in Detail Before Signing on the Dotted Line

It doesn’t matter if you discussed your expectations and the agent’s fees extensively. You should always read your contract in detail before signing on the dotted line.

Your contract should include all the terms and conditions you agreed. Make sure to verify it details all fees and the agent’s commission.
